What is CBD?

CBD is one among numerous active elements found in the cannabis plant, classified as cannabinoids. These substances affect the endocannabinoid system in the body, a array of receptors responsible for maintaining equilibrium. The ECS plays a role in regulating physical pain, mood, appetite, and sleep.

Unlike THC, CBD is non-intoxicating. This quality makes CBD an appealing choice for those seeking assistance with pain, anxiety, and other issues without the mind-altering effects of marijuana or some medications.

CBD Oil: The Most Common Type of CBD

CBD oil is obtained from the cannabis plant and then diluted with a copyright oil, like hemp seed or coconut oil, to make it easier to consume. CBD oil can be taken CBD in various different ways:

• Orally: Applying drops under the tongue enables rapid absorption.

• Topically: CBD oil can be applied directly on the skin for direct application or skin conditions.

• Ingestion: CBD oil can be included in food or drinks.

Potential Therapeutic Uses of CBD and CBD Oil

1. Pain Management
o CBD is commonly used to help with pain. It may reduce inflammation and influence pain-signaling receptors, which may aid people experiencing chronic pain conditions like arthritis or fibromyalgia.

2. Mood Disorders

o Studies indicate that CBD may alleviate anxiety by interacting with serotonin receptors, that control mood and social behavior. CBD is seen as a natural alternative to pharmaceutical options for some people.

3. Better Sleep Quality

o For those struggling with insomnia or restlessness, CBD may offer help. Some studies show that CBD could reduce REM sleep disorders and promote more restful sleep.

4. Cognitive Support

o Current studies are exploring, but early findings propose that CBD might protect against neurodegenerative diseases like Alzheimer’s and Parkinson’s by limiting neuroinflammation.

5. Dermatological Benefits

o CBD oil’s anti-inflammatory properties have made it a popular addition in skincare products. It may combat acne, control psoriasis, and provide moisture for dry skin.

Considering CBD?

Before using CBD, speak to a healthcare professional, especially if you are currently on medication. CBD is generally well-tolerated, but some individuals may notice reactions like drowsiness, dry mouth, or digestive issues.
